Transaction a580fae63cd5f261a301cccaa3b3a2f3389f3a91afef01b14818431a8ee4a3c2

4 Input
1 Outputs
  • a580fae63cd5f261a301cccaa3b3a2f3389f3a91afef01b14818431a8ee4a3c2:0
  • value  127510000
    address  37XUCYo4keVpjwmkM8od2iQznV3dd25dWy